The requirements are waived entirely in Chicago and Minneapolis for lots 33 feet or less in width which are developed for residential purposes, and for which there is no access from an alley. Vacant lots may thus be converted to parking lots to accommodate the needs of nearby apartment buildings. The Federal Housing Administration has included recommendations for off-street parking in its land-use intensity ratings.4 As shown in Table 3, the suggested requirements vary with the intensity of development rather than with the type of housing or zoning district. The residence "A" district of the Dearborn, Michigan, ordinance permits "a parking space for the parking of non-commercial vehicles, or commercial motor vehicles weighing not more than 4,000 pounds, if operated by customers of business in adjoining business districts, as an accessory use to such adjoining business district, but not further than 125 feet measured at right angles from the residential property line adjacent to such business district." Prohibited acts include: in front of a public or private driveway, within twenty feet of a crosswalk at an intersection, within thirty feet of a stop sign or traffic control device, between a safety zone and the adjacent curb, within fifty feet of a railroad crossing, within twenty feet of a driveway entrance to any fire station or on the opposite side of the street, alongside or opposite any street excavation or obstruction that would obstruct traffic, alongside any vehicle stopped or parked on the street, upon any bridge, an elevated highway, or tunnel, within one foot of another parked vehicle. In Philadelphia the basic requirement of one space per dwelling unit, regardless of district, is reduced to one space per two dwelling units for buildings containing 25 or more units in the "center city." The provision of Berkeley, California, deals with this design element quite completely: In any R District, any off-street parking area for 3 or more cars shall be effectively screened from surrounding structures and uses, including those uses which face such areas across a street or alley. When a group parking facility is provided, the requirement is equivalent to the individual requirement in the R1 through R4 districts (one space per dwelling unit), but it is reduced to 8.5, 7, 6 and 5 spaces per 10 dwelling units in the RS, R6, R7, and R7-2 districts, respectively, and to 4 spaces per 10 dwelling units in the R8, R9, and RIO districts. Some ordinances regulate the location of a trailer on the lot; in Merced County, it must conform to the setback requirements; in Pima County, it must be placed on the back half of the lot; in Warren, Michigan, it must be located 10 feet from any dwelling or property line. As with commercial vehicles, only a few ordinances regulate the overnight parking and storage of travel trailers and mobile homes on residential lots. The difficulty is not in obtaining the land (the use of eminent domain), but in financing the acquisition of land and the construction of parking lots. In Boston the number of off-street spaces required for residential uses is based on the floor area ratio and is thus similar to the FHA approach. The FHA standards are unique in that they recommend a different ratio of parking spaces to dwelling units for residents (occupant car ratio) and for visitors (total car ratio). Local authorities by ordinance may permit angle parking on any roadway under their jurisdiction, except that angle parking shall not be permitted on a state route within a municipal corporation unless an unoccupied roadway width of not less than twenty-five feet is available for free-moving traffic.
